A well-structured SME chart of accounts
A good chart of accounts tells the story of the business: classes 1 and 2 describe what it owns and owes, class 3 what it sells, classes 4 to 6 what it consumes. Private accounts (sole proprietorships) and shareholder current accounts (Sàrl/SA) must stay spotless: they are the first thing examined in a tax audit.
For a business in Zuzgen, comparability over time beats sophistication: a chart stable for five years beats a “perfect” one rebuilt every year. Banks and the tax administration read year-on-year movements first.

The Swiss legal frame for QR-bill invoicing
In Switzerland, the duty to keep accounts stems from art. 957 ff. of the Code of Obligations. Legal entities (Sàrl, SA) and sole proprietorships with at least CHF 500,000 in revenue keep full accounts: balance sheet, income statement and notes. Below that threshold, a simplified record of income, expenses and assets is sufficient.
The good news: the Swiss frame is stable and predictable. Structure QR-bill invoicing once — chart of accounts, document flow, calendar — and the same organisation pays off for years.

Effective VAT method or net tax rate: how to choose?
The effective method deducts actual input VAT and files quarterly; the net tax rate method applies a flat industry rate to turnover, semi-annually, with no separate input VAT deduction. The flat rate suits low-cost structures; as investments grow, the effective method usually wins again. The choice rests on the company's own figures, in Zuzgen as anywhere.

How long must records related to QR-bill invoicing be kept?
Ten years from the end of the financial year concerned (art. 958f CO). Electronic retention is permitted if the integrity and readability of the records are guaranteed — a serious digital archive validly replaces paper binders. A business in Zuzgen can therefore archive fully digitally.
